Core Viewpoint - Youyou Food's subsidiary, Youyou Food Chongqing Manufacturing Co., Ltd., has invested 20 million yuan in an investment fund with a total scale of approximately 482.85 million yuan, representing a 4.1421% stake in the fund [1][2]. Investment Details - The investment fund primarily focuses on sectors such as biomanufacturing, agricultural technology, food engineering and supply chain, and agricultural machinery and related equipment [1]. - The fund aims to enhance business synergy, expand investment layout, and capture opportunities in related industries, aligning with the company's development strategy and shareholder interests [1]. Fund Partners - The investment fund is established in partnership with 10 institutions and individuals, including Guangdong Wens Investment Co., Ltd., Yunnan Plateau Characteristic Agriculture Equity Investment Fund, and Hengqin Guangdong-Macao Deep Cooperation Zone Industrial Investment Fund [2][3]. - Notably, Wens Investment is fully controlled by Wens Foodstuffs Group, which is a leading enterprise in the agricultural sector, indicating a strategic alignment with Youyou Food's core business in food processing [3]. Capital Contribution Structure - The total capital contribution of the fund is 48.285 million yuan, with Wens Investment and Yunnan Plateau Fund each contributing 16 million yuan, accounting for 33.1366% of the total [3]. - Youyou Food's contribution of 2 million yuan represents 4.1421% of the total fund, indicating a relatively low impact on the company's net assets and operational activities [4]. Funding Phases - The initial phase will require partners to pay 50% of their subscribed capital, with the second phase contingent on the completion of 70% of the first phase's investment [4].

Group 1: Silver Market Insights - The report highlights a significant market perception gap regarding silver, emphasizing that its long-term price trends are more closely correlated with gold than industrial demand [8]. - It argues that the market has overestimated the impact of industrial demand on silver prices while underestimating the investment demand driven by its financial attributes [8]. - The report suggests that even with a decline in photovoltaic demand, silver may still maintain a supply-demand gap due to recovering investment demand [8]. Group 1 - The current A-share market is experiencing an upward trend, but many investors are concerned about the lack of trading volume supporting this rise, questioning its sustainability [1] - The market dynamics have fundamentally changed, with policy being the main driving force rather than trading volume, indicating that significant price movements can occur even with low trading volumes [1][2] - Official background funds are actively stabilizing the market, with interventions noted after trade issues arose, suggesting a strong influence from state-backed entities [2] Group 2 - Long-term capital is being guided into the market, which will hold onto shares and reduce the available floating shares, potentially leading to a new normal of stable trading volumes [2] - The consumer sector is expected to present investment opportunities, with recent market gains primarily in banking, gold, and consumer sectors, driven more by inflation expectations than by domestic demand policies [2] - The logic behind the rise in essential consumer goods is tied to inflation expectations rather than an expansion of market size, as traditional consumption levels remain unchanged [3]
